Golden Goose

Former White Sox pitcher Goose Gossage goes into the Hall of Fame today and it is a well-deserved and overdue honor.

I was fortunate enough to play with Goose near the end of his career and being around him was a learning experience each and every day.

He had fun in the lockerroom, but knew how to go about his business. Goose was a true professional in every sense of the word, not to mention one of the premiere relievers in baseball history. He never made excuses whether he was lights out or getting lit up. I am proud to have been his teammate and very happy for him today on his big day in Cooperstown.
